A 74-yr-old man with two prior coronary bypass surgeries experienced perforation of an occluded aortocoronary vein graft during a transluminal extraction catheter (TEC) procedure for unstable angina. The perforation was successfully closed using a Palmaz 154 stent covered with a short segment of autologous antecubital vein.
